What is the girl carrying when leading a nation in the parade of nations for Olympics 2012?

In the 2012 Parade of Nations, the girls leading each country's athletes were carrying the petal of a giant flower. Its purpose becomes evident at the end. When the games are finished, the flower will be dismantled and each country gets to take a petal home.


When did girls soccer come to the Olympics?

The first women's football Olympic competition was at the 1996 Games in Atlanta.

When did the Olympics start to let girls compete?

Women were able to participate in the Olympics starting in 1900.
